Product Description:
The HDS02.2-W040N-HS56-01-FW is a drive controller manufactured by Bosch Rexroth Indramat and positioned within the HDS Drive Controllers series. It supplies regulated power and motion commands to compatible servo modules, forming the axis control layer in automated machinery. Within an industrial cell, the unit links motion commands from a higher-level PLC to the power stage that actuates motors, allowing coordinated multi-axis movement. This arrangement supports controlled torque and speed response on connected servo axes during normal machine operation.
At the communication level, the controller exchanges cyclic setpoints and diagnostics over the SERCOS fiber-optic bus, which synchronizes multiple axes inside the DIAX04 family. Internally, a built-in air blower moves cooling air across the power electronics, so no external heat sink is required. The power section is rated for 40 A of continuous output, allowing it to drive medium-capacity servo motors under nominal conditions. The enclosure has an IP10 protection rating, and the windings and conductors use insulation class C per DIN VDE 0110 for elevated thermal endurance during repetitive acceleration duties. The unit is part of Line 02 and Design Version 2 of the DIAX04 controller platform. Its cooling path is integrated into the housing, which keeps airflow directed across the internal power section.
The installation envelope permits operation up to 1000 m above sea level, so no additional cooling margin is required until higher elevations are reached. During standard service, the electronics operate in ambient temperatures from +5 °C to +45 °C. Intermittent use can continue until the heat sink reaches +55 °C, after which staged derating is applied. During transport or long-term storage, the unit can tolerate temperatures from -30 °C to +85 °C without damage when it is not powered.
